Разрешение Pulseaudio/X другой user/SSH

Не используйте склонный - добираются, но dpkg:

dpkg -L package-name
5
04.06.2012, 08:50
1 ответ

Как «пользователь2»

echo "default-server = unix:/tmp/pulse-socket" >> ~user2/.config/pulse/client.conf

Как «пользователь1»

echo "load-module module-native-protocol-unix auth-anonymous=1 socket=/tmp/pulse-socket" >> ~user1/.config/pulse/default.pa

затем перезапустите сервер:

pulseaudio --kill
pulseaudio --start

Отлично работает с 'su' (или 'su -l' ). Я не пробовал с «ssh», но он должен работать так же.

Вы также можете ограничить доступ, используя параметры модуля -собственный -протокол -unix, как в:

load-module module-native-protocol-unix auth-group=othergroup socket=/tmp/pulse-socket

Источник:

См. абзац Arch WikiРазрешение нескольким пользователям одновременно использовать PulseAudio

1
27.01.2020, 20:44

Теги

Похожие вопросы